What Remains: Evidence and Method in Paranormal Investigation challenges the two failures that have long defined paranormal investigation: belief without discipline, and evidence without method. Drawing on decades of field experience, a background in psychology, years in law, and experience overseeing scientific research programs, William A. Smith offers a practical framework for investigating unexplained claims with rigor, fairness, and intellectual honesty. From witness interviews and case intake to contamination control, chain of custody, environmental baselines, audio review, logical reasoning, and ethical reporting, this book replaces hype and performance with real investigative standards. This is not a debunking manual. It is not a believer’s handbook. It is a guide for those willing to do the work carefully enough to earn the right to say that something still does not add up. Ideal for paranormal investigators, skeptics, researchers, journalists, and curious readers interested in how extraordinary claims should actually be examined.
